The Position

Please note that this role offers a fixed-term contract (until Dec 31, 2025), with the potential for extension based on project needs and performance.

The Record to Report (R2R) Department provides financial services for over 130 affiliates in the EMEA region, covering areas such as General Ledger Accounting, Management Accounting, Treasury, and Accounts Receivable. The department is expanding as we aim to perform end-to-end accounting activities.

The Opportunity

As a Senior Financial Accountant, you will perform daily and closing activities in collaboration with cross-functional departments, adhering to deadlines and maintaining full ownership of your tasks in line with process documentation. Your responsibilities will include:

  • Calculating and issuing AR manual invoices, managing daily bank postings, leased assets, fixed assets, CAPEX accounting, taxes, GL journals, accruals, and handling rejected and returned payments, as well as reconciling treasury transactions.
  • Clearing customer accounts, collecting direct debit payments, contacting customers, managing AR and bank suspense accounts, allocating cash, and credit management.
  • Reconciling and reporting intercompany balances and clearing B/S accounts.
  • Defining and calculating cost and revenue allocations in controlling.
  • Conducting product closing in SAP's Material Management module.
  • Preparing reports for consolidation.
  • Preparing audit documentation and participating in internal and external audits.
